Ambient hydrogenation of CO2 to methane with highly efficient and stable single-atom silver-manganese catalysts

Published in 2019 at "Journal of Alloys and Compounds"

DOI: 10.1016/j.jallcom.2018.10.352

Abstract: Abstract This research focused on developing an efficient and stable single-atom silver-manganese catalysts (Ag-HMO) for converting the increasingly concerning CO2 to highly demanded methane (CH4) via ambient photocatalytic hydrogenation with renewable H2. The catalytic performances… read more here.

Single-atom silver-borophene hybrid hydrogels for electrically stimulated wound healing: a multifunctional antibacterial platform.

Published in 2025 at "Biomaterials science"

DOI: 10.1039/d5bm00609k

Abstract: Chronic wound healing demands next-generation biomaterials that includes antibacterial properties, electrical responsiveness, and tissue-regenerative capabilities. This study presents a multifunctional hydrogel that incorporates single-atom silver (Ag-SA) and two-dimensional borophene nanosheets (BNSs) within a PVA/chitosan matrix… read more here.
